Weather forecast for tomorrow 16. Hot weather shows signs of decreasing across the country. Warning of flash flood risk in the next 6 hours in some areas of Quang Ngai, Gia Lai.

The National Center for Hydro-Meteorological Forecasting has updated the weather forecast for tonight and tomorrow (April 16) in regions across the country.

On April 16, the area from Nghe An to Hue City continued to experience hot and intense heat, especially intense in some places. The highest temperature is commonly from 36-38 degrees C, in some places above 39 degrees C, the relative lowest humidity fluctuates from 55-60%.

The Northwest region, Thanh Hoa, Central Highlands and Southern regions record localized hot weather, with the highest temperature in some places exceeding 35 degrees Celsius.

Hot weather expands in the Central and South Central Coast, Central Highlands such as Da Nang City and the East of provinces from Quang Ngai to Dak Lak maintaining hot weather, in some places intense hot weather with the highest temperature commonly 35-37 degrees C, in some places above 37 degrees C; low humidity from 55-60%.

As of April 17, the area from Hue City to Da Nang City and the eastern area from Quang Ngai to Dak Lak will still have hot weather, with common temperatures of 35-36 degrees Celsius, in some places above 37 degrees Celsius. However, widespread hot weather in the area from Nghe An to Quang Tri tends to decrease and end on April 17.

Forecast from April 18, widespread hot weather in the Central Central region will end.

Northern region changes to rain, temperature drops

From the night of April 16 to April 17, due to the influence of cold air compressing low pressure troughs combined with high-altitude wind convergence, the Northern region (except Lai Chau, Dien Bien) and Thanh Hoa will have moderate to heavy rain, with very heavy rain in some places.

Common rainfall: 20–40mm, locally over 100mm. From April 17, the North turns cool, the temperature drops significantly.

Rainstorms in the Central Highlands and accompanying natural disaster warnings

In the late afternoon and evening of April 15, the Central Highlands area will have scattered showers and thunderstorms, rainfall of 10-20mm, in some places over 50mm.

Prevent dangerous phenomena that may occur such as tornadoes, lightning, hail, strong gusts of wind, flash floods on small rivers and streams, landslides in hilly areas, flooding in low-lying areas...
